Miyabi, a prestigious Japanese brand, is renowned for its exceptional kitchen knives. Combining traditional Japanese craftsmanship with modern German engineering, Miyabi knives offer unparalleled sharpness, precision, and durability. Crafted with meticulous attention to detail, each Miyabi knife embodies the beauty and elegance of Japanese culinary artistry.
